Zum Inhalt springen

JSP / Java Web


Empfohlene Beiträge

Gast KnapsackSolver
Geschrieben

Hallo Community,

ich habe mit der Hilfe von Netbeans eine Java Web Anwendung programmiert. Jetzt die dumme Frage, was kommt dabei am Schluss raus?

Wenn man ein Java-Projekt hat, erzeugt man am Ende eine JAR-Datei, was für eine Datei führe ich am Schluss aus, damit das erstellte Projekt auch ohne IDE funktioniert?

Eine JSP Datei kann ja nicht wie eine HTML oder PHP Datei geöffnet werden. Grüße

Geschrieben

Man braucht natürlich eine Server-Software, auf dem die Webapplikation läuft. Beim Entwickeln der App wurde ja bestimmt schon einer ausgewählt, meistens Glasfish oder Apache Tomcat. Eines davon (am besten das, unter der du auch entwickelt hast) auf dem Zielserver installieren, die Webseite einrichten und fertig.

Geschrieben

Naja, so eindeutig ist das heute ja auch nicht mehr. Es gibt auch Frameworks wie Spring Boot, die einen embedded $Irgendwas mitbringen, oder so Dinger wie Apache Spark, wo ebenfalls ein JAR rauskommt. Das Oldskool-Artefakt ist ein .war oder ein .ear.

Eine JSP Datei kann ja nicht wie eine HTML oder PHP Datei geöffnet werden.

Das hat aber alles nichts direkt mit dem Outputformat zu tun.

1) PHP kann man auch nicht "einfach so" im Browser öffnen. Es muss ebenfalls in irgendeiner Form voher prozessiert werden

2) Hängt das mit den Frameworks bzw. Servern zusammen, die die Seiten jeweils (vor-)kompilieren vor (dem ersten) Aufruf

Gast KnapsackSolver
Geschrieben

Also kurze Zwischenmeldung, ich bekomme eine .war Datei heraus. Wenn ich diese Datei in mein Tomcat Verzeichnis kopiere und dann per Tomcat Starte, erstellt das ein Verzeichnis mit allen Dateien etc. die in diesem Projekt waren, ist das normal?

Ansonsten, es funktioniert alles wie gewünscht ;)

Dein Kommentar

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.

Gast
Auf dieses Thema antworten...

×   Du hast formatierten Text eingefügt.   Formatierung wiederherstellen

  Nur 75 Emojis sind erlaubt.

×   Dein Link wurde automatisch eingebettet.   Einbetten rückgängig machen und als Link darstellen

×   Dein vorheriger Inhalt wurde wiederhergestellt.   Editor leeren

×   Du kannst Bilder nicht direkt einfügen. Lade Bilder hoch oder lade sie von einer URL.

Fachinformatiker.de, 2024 by SE Internet Services

fidelogo_small.png

Schicke uns eine Nachricht!

Fachinformatiker.de ist die größte IT-Community
rund um Ausbildung, Job, Weiterbildung für IT-Fachkräfte.

Fachinformatiker.de App

Download on the App Store
Get it on Google Play

Kontakt

Hier werben?
Oder sende eine E-Mail an

Social media u. feeds

Jobboard für Fachinformatiker und IT-Fachkräfte

×
×
  • Neu erstellen...